If your worried about a noise complaint with the chickens. Try Muscovy ducks. They are called the quiet duck, they are not noiseless, but they hiss and make other noises. Its not as loud as chickens. But you do have to trim wings so they cant fly. Im real tired. So cant write much. For more info just google them. Or search them here.
 
If they're legal to have I don't think you'd get complaints from a couple of hens' "egg song". However, if they're not legal to have and you think you can keep them a secret, good luck. My three pullets scream at the top of their lungs each day when they are about to lay their egg/want a spot in the nest box/just feel like it. I have 1/2 an acre and 6ft privacy fencing, but if you're outside, my girls can be heard down the street. They're by no means noisy all day, but they're definitely not "stealth" chickens either.
